About 9-[3-[4-cyano-3-[2-(3-cyanocarbazol-9-yl)-3-methylcyclohexa-1,5-dien-1-yl]phenyl]phenyl]carbazole-3-carbonitrile

9-[3-[4-cyano-3-[2-(3-cyanocarbazol-9-yl)-3-methylcyclohexa-1,5-dien-1-yl]phenyl]phenyl]carbazole-3-carbonitrile (PubChem CID 155086189) has the molecular formula C46H29N5 and a molecular weight of 651.77 g/mol. Its IUPAC name is 9-[3-[4-cyano-3-[2-(3-cyanocarbazol-9-yl)-3-methylcyclohexa-1,5-dien-1-yl]phenyl]phenyl]carbazole-3-carbonitrile.
